MiR-31 activates Wnt and represses TGFβ signaling pathways. a Wnt signals were evaluated by Axin2-LacZ reporter activity in mammary ducts from Control (n = 3) and DTG (n = 3) mice, as well as Control (n = 3) and miR-31 KO (n = 3) mice. Blue, LacZ signals. Scale bar, 100 μm. b Immunohistochemistry for β-Catenin in Control (n = 3) and DTG (n = 3) mammary glands at 12 weeks of age and 14.5 d.p.c. Arrows, nuclear localized β-Catenin. Scale bar, 25 μm. c Western blotting for β-Catenin in Control (n = 3) and miR-31 KO (n = 3) mice. GAPDH was used as a loading control. d Immunofluorescence for β-Catenin in HC11 mouse mammary epithelial cells in the presence of Dox (miR-31 overexpression). Control, without Dox. Red, β-Catenin; Blue, DAPI. n = 3 technical replicates. e Western blotting for Wnt target LBH in miR-31 overexpressing (Dox) or miR-31 inhibited (anti-miR-31) HC11 mammary epithelial cells. The Control HC11 cells were treated with Scramble RNA. n = 3 technical replicates. f TOP/FOPflash luciferase assays demonstrate that Dox induced miR-31 overexpression activates Wnt reporter gene expression and that miR-31 inhibitor (anti-miR-31) markedly represses Wnt reporter gene expression. Scramble RNA was used as negative control (NC). n = 3 technical replicates. g Western blotting for Smad3, p-Smad2/3 and p21 in mammary epithelial cells of Control (n = 3) and miR-31 KO (n = 3) mice at 10 weeks of age. h qRT-PCR analysis for TGFβ components and downstream target genes, Cdkn2b (encoding p15), Cdkn1a (encoding p21), Cdkn1c (encoding p57) and Tgfbr1 in mammary epithelial cells of Control (n = 3) and miR-31 KO (n = 3) mice at 10 weeks of age. i HC11 mammary epithelial cells were transfected with CAGA luciferase reporter vector, combined with scrambled RNA (negative control, NC), miR-31 mimics or miR-31 inhibitor (anti-miR-31) for 24 h and then harvested for luciferase activity determination. n = 3 biological replicates. Data represented as mean ± S.D. n = 3. Two tailed unpaired t-test for f, h, i (*P < 0.05; **P < 0.01; ***P < 0.001)
